Default LS1 Omega project, engine/headers/chassis

Hi, seriously concidering swapping a v8 into my uk omega (Catera in the u.s.). However some research shows it to be a very tight fit between the rear cylinders and chassis. Sourcing a pair of exhaust manifolds/headers is going to be dificult although it has been done. I think a guy called Elvin made it work?

The GM ones made for the scrapped Official v8 omega show the rear primarys have an almost restrictive flat pressed onto the rear cylinder exhaust where it exits the heads to give clearance from the chassis.

Just wondered if any body has any here has any info or sugestions?

I think mine has 2000 Corvette cast headers, they miss the steering box - just !!
Because the Omega has a steering box and the Commodore a rack it doesn't leave you much room to play with between the roll bar and steering cross link.
